Yuancun Station (Chinese: 员村站) is an interchange station between Line 5 and Line 21 of the Guangzhou Metro, and also the terminus of Line 21.[1] It is located under the junction of Huacheng Avenue East (Chinese: 花城大道东) and Yuancun 2nd Cross Road (Chinese: 员村二横路) in the Tianhe District. It lies to the east of Zhujiang New Town and to the north of Pazhou,[2][3][4] and was opened on 28 December 2009.[5]

The station has 2 underground island platforms, one for each line.

Exits[]

There are 6 exits, lettered A, B, C, D, E and F. Exit A, B and E are accessible. All exits are located on Yuancun 2nd Cross Road.
